Noah Vilgrain
My name is Noah Vilgrain. I was born with a brain atrophy which affected thirty percent of my brain to be useless. The doctors told my parents, I would never talk, be intelligent or have meaningful relationships with anyone. They told my parents I should be sent to a home and forgotten about. My mother never gave up on me and worked with me so that I could be able to live somewhat of a normal life. As it turns out my brain has the amazing capacity to heal itself. So throughout my entire life I went from one end of the spectrum to the other. After years of therapy and always working hard, I managed to get to the other side where I technically don't have autism. And yet I still have traits, my identity was that of a person with autism and was difficult to navigate who I was. In steps with the wonderful help of psychedelics which taught me how to be myself, how to navigate the world and how I could connect with other people on a much deeper level.

Episode 122: Extended State DMT Experiences & The Future Of Psychedelic Medicines (feat. Daniel McQueen)
This One Time On Psychedelics
07/28/23 • 82 min
For anyone who has had the opportunity to experience the powers of DMT, you know full well what that experience can bring forth. This being said, for many people, this medicine can create a lot of anxiety as it comes on intense & fast & also, due to the fast & strong nature of it, leave many individuals puzzled as to how to contextualize their experience & how to then integrate from it. Today's guest on the show is a returning guest who is a pioneer in the realms of Cannabis, Psilocybin, Ketamine & DMT & in this episode we will be focusing primarily on his most recent venture, DMTX. DMTX is an extended state DMT experience in which the individual moving through the experience can be brought into the effects of the medicine in a slower, controlled manner & also be kept in that state longer than with other forms, such as when smoking DMT. He has been working on this project for quite some time & his overarching business, The Center For Medicinal Mindfulness, has been a long-time juggernaut in the plant medicine space in helping its clients not only benefit from the powers of Cannabis & now Psilocybin, Ketamine & DMT but also receive training in how to replicate these results for others as well!

About Daniel
Daniel McQueen, MA, is a Psychedelic Specialist, Educator, and Author of the book, Psychedelic Cannabis: Therapeutic Methods and Unique Blends to Treat Trauma and Transform Consciousness. In 2012 he co-founded the first legal psychedelic plant medicine therapy center in the United States, the Center for Medicinal Mindfulness which is located in Boulder, Colorado, and is currently celebrating its 10-year anniversary. The same year, Daniel also founded Psychedelic Sitters School, which continues to train students from around the world in Mindfulness-Based Psychedelic Therapy and Cannabis-Assisted Psychedelic Therapy.

About Paul
Paul F. Austin is an entrepreneur, public speaker, and educator. He has founded two companies in the emerging psychedelic space, Third Wave and Synthesis.
Within Third Wave, Paul leads his team in building an educational platform to ensure psychedelic substances become responsibly integrated into our cultural framework.
Currently, Third Wave offers long-form psychedelic guides, online microdosing programs, and an industry-best network of clinics and retreat providers.
In 2018, Paul co-founded Synthesis, and led several high-dose psilocybin truffle retreats over the span of one year. When not leading retreats, Paul headed up branding, marketing, and public relations for Synthesis before stepping back to focus on Third Wave full-time.
Because of his pioneering work at the intersection of psychedelic use, personal transformation, and professional success, Paul has been featured in the BBC, Forbes, and Rolling Stone.
Paul sees psychedelic use as a skill, one that becomes more refined as we explore the many nuances of these awe-inspiring medicines and molecules.
Learning how to hone this skill will be crucial in the story of humanity’s present-future evolution.
